Defining Web-Based Market Research Platforms
Web-based market research platforms are online tools and software applications designed to facilitate the collection, analysis, and interpretation of data for market research purposes. These platforms offer a streamlined approach to conducting surveys, focus groups, and other research methodologies, leveraging the power of the internet to reach a wider and more diverse audience than traditional methods. They provide a centralized location for managing the entire research process, from questionnaire design to report generation.These platforms vary significantly in their functionality and features, depending on the target user.
Core functionalities typically include survey creation and distribution, data collection and management, data analysis tools, and reporting capabilities. Distinguishing features can include advanced analytics, integration with other software, and specialized modules for particular research types, such as A/B testing or conjoint analysis.

Advantages and Disadvantages of Web-Based Market Research Platforms
Web-based market research platforms offer several key advantages over traditional methods. Cost-effectiveness is a significant benefit, as online platforms often eliminate the expenses associated with printing, postage, and manual data entry. Furthermore, they allow for faster data collection and analysis, enabling quicker turnaround times for research projects. The ability to reach geographically dispersed respondents expands the potential sample size and improves the representativeness of the findings.
However, challenges exist. Online surveys can suffer from sampling bias if the target population lacks internet access or is less likely to participate online. Data quality can also be an issue if respondents are not carefully screened or if the survey design is flawed. Furthermore, maintaining respondent anonymity and data security is crucial and requires robust platform security measures.
Finally, the lack of direct interaction with respondents can limit the depth of insights gained compared to in-person interviews or focus groups.

Survey Methodologies
Surveys are a cornerstone of web-based market research. They allow researchers to gather quantitative and qualitative data efficiently through structured questionnaires delivered online. This method provides scalability and cost-effectiveness, allowing for large sample sizes and quick data collection.
- Pros: Cost-effective, scalable, quick data collection, easy to analyze quantitative data, allows for a wide range of question types (multiple choice, rating scales, open-ended).
- Cons: Potential for response bias, lower response rates compared to other methods, limitations in capturing nuanced qualitative data, potential for survey fatigue.
Online Polls
Polls, often shorter and more focused than surveys, are designed to quickly gauge opinions on specific topics. They are ideal for collecting data on simple preferences or current events. Their simplicity makes them particularly effective for capturing real-time insights and trending opinions.
- Pros: Simple and easy to administer, quick data collection, ideal for gathering opinions on specific topics, low cost.
- Cons: Limited depth of information, potential for biased responses, may not capture the complexity of opinions.
Online Focus Groups
Web-based platforms facilitate online focus groups, offering a cost-effective alternative to in-person sessions. These virtual gatherings allow researchers to interact with participants in real-time, facilitating richer discussions and deeper qualitative insights. Moderators guide the conversation, ensuring that all participants contribute.
- Pros: Cost-effective, geographically diverse participants, convenient for participants, rich qualitative data, real-time interaction.
- Cons: Requires skilled moderation, potential for technical difficulties, difficulty in observing non-verbal cues, potential for participant dominance.
Online Interviews
Online interviews, conducted via video conferencing or other digital tools, provide a more personalized approach than surveys or focus groups. They allow for in-depth exploration of individual perspectives and detailed qualitative data collection. This method is particularly useful for exploring complex issues or gathering in-depth background information.
- Pros: Rich qualitative data, allows for in-depth exploration of individual perspectives, flexible scheduling, convenient for both interviewer and interviewee.
- Cons: Can be time-consuming, more expensive than surveys or polls, requires skilled interviewers, potential for interviewer bias.
Data Privacy and Security
Web-based market research platforms prioritize data privacy and security. Robust measures are typically implemented to protect participant information. This often includes encryption of data during transmission and storage, adherence to data protection regulations (like GDPR and CCPA), and clear consent procedures. Many platforms offer anonymization options to further protect participant identity. Data access is often restricted to authorized personnel only.
For example, platforms may utilize secure servers and firewalls to prevent unauthorized access, employing robust encryption protocols such as HTTPS to protect data transmitted between the platform and users’ devices. They also often implement data anonymization techniques to remove personally identifiable information where possible, replacing it with unique identifiers to maintain data integrity while protecting individual privacy.
Analyzing and Interpreting Data
Web-based market research platforms offer sophisticated tools to analyze the data collected, transforming raw figures into actionable insights. The process typically involves several key steps, from cleaning and preparing the data to visualizing and interpreting the results. Effective analysis is crucial for understanding market trends, customer behavior, and ultimately, making informed business decisions.Data analysis within these platforms typically begins with data cleaning.
This crucial step involves identifying and correcting or removing inconsistencies, errors, and outliers in the collected data. This might include handling missing values, dealing with incorrect entries, and ensuring data consistency across different variables. Data transformation follows, where the raw data is manipulated to make it more suitable for analysis. This can involve converting data types, creating new variables, or standardizing data for better comparison.
Finally, data visualization techniques bring the data to life, allowing researchers to easily identify patterns, trends, and relationships.
Data Cleaning and Transformation Techniques
Data cleaning often involves techniques such as outlier detection and removal, using statistical methods like the interquartile range (IQR) to identify data points that significantly deviate from the norm. Missing data can be handled through imputation, using methods like mean imputation or more sophisticated techniques like k-nearest neighbors. Data transformation might include standardizing variables using z-scores to ensure they have a similar scale, or creating dummy variables for categorical data to allow for quantitative analysis.
These processes are often automated or semi-automated within the platform, streamlining the analytical workflow.
Data Visualization Methods
Data visualization is paramount for interpreting market research findings. Different visualization methods are suitable for different types of data and research questions.
A bar chart effectively displays the frequency or proportion of different categories, such as customer demographics or brand preferences. For example, a bar chart could show the percentage of respondents who prefer Brand A versus Brand B. The length of each bar directly represents the magnitude of the category.
Pie charts, similar to bar charts, show the proportion of different categories within a whole. However, pie charts are best suited for displaying a smaller number of categories, usually no more than 5 or 6, to maintain clarity. For instance, a pie chart might illustrate the market share of various competing products within an industry.
Line graphs are excellent for illustrating trends over time. They are useful for showing changes in sales figures, website traffic, or customer satisfaction scores over a specific period. A line graph could show the growth of a company’s market share over a five-year period.
Scatter plots are valuable for exploring the relationship between two continuous variables. For example, a scatter plot might reveal the correlation between customer age and spending habits. The closer the points cluster to a straight line, the stronger the correlation.
Heatmaps visually represent data using color gradients, allowing researchers to identify patterns and correlations in large datasets. For example, a heatmap could show the customer satisfaction ratings across different product features. Warmer colors indicate higher satisfaction scores, while cooler colors represent lower scores.

Enhanced Data Security and Privacy
Growing concerns about data privacy and security will continue to shape the development of web-based market research platforms. We can anticipate increased adoption of privacy-enhancing technologies (PETs), such as differential privacy and federated learning, to protect respondent data while still allowing for meaningful analysis. Platforms will need to be transparent about their data handling practices and comply with evolving regulations like GDPR and CCPA.
This will necessitate the implementation of robust security measures and data anonymization techniques. The focus will shift from simply collecting large amounts of data to collecting high-quality, ethically sourced data.
